Position Summary

This is position responsible for recommending division policies, development of work programs and objectives, assisting in the development of operating and capital budget items, and assisting in the resolution of difficult administrative and technical concerns. Additionally, this position is responsible for designing, installing, securing and administering computer networks with secondary duties of providing personal computer technical support. Work involves analyzing information needs, testing and installing new computer software and systems, as well as performing computer network administrative tasks.

Primary Duties:

  • Ensures desktop security, server security, Network Security and overall cyber security per CLA Policy.
  • Log, analyze and report on security incidents.
  • Reviews logs from security tools, including firewalls, switches, VPN, vulnerability assessment.
  • tools, anti-virus, etc.
  • Monitor networks to ensure reliability and efficient communications. Perform preventive maintenance and troubleshoot network operations. Write network procedures and develop schematic documentation.
  • Analyze and document user requirements and recommend hardware and software alternatives. Formulate procedures and practices to assure acceptable network system performance.
  • Assists with investigations as required during the course of security incidents including forensics, diagnosis, repair and recovery.
  • Creates, modifies, tests, and implements system programs for all computer platforms.
  • Provide operation support for database software and determine ways to store, organize, backup and maintain data.
  • Designs, implements and maintains enterprise level complex databases.
  • Provides system and user documentation on the data architecture and associated applications.
  • Assists the Leadership team in day-to-day project management when necessary.
  • Assists the Leadership Team in the selection of enterprise and local level software applications.
  • Works with system administrators to design, manage, and support local and wide area network.
  • Assists in problem determination and resolution and provides support for all package solutions.
  • Trains users on use of internally developed applications.
  • Install, configure, test and maintain all network infrastructure devices, software and peripheral equipment. Monitor activity and performs necessary maintenance to ensure reliability and efficiency.
